Vango Mining intersects broad, high-grade gold zones at Marymia Gold Project in Western Australia

Vango Mining Ltd (ASX:VAN) has completed the second phase of drilling at the Skyhawk open-pit in the Marymia Gold Project of Western Australia, intersecting wide bands of high-grade gold zones that confirm the potential for an open-pit approach to the resource.

The drilling at Skyhawk consisted of six reverse circulation holes for 1,014 metres, with notable gold returned in five holes. Highlight assay results include:

➢ 15 metres at 3.5 g/t gold from 113 metres, including 7 metres at 6.6 g/t from 119 metres; and

➢ 12 metres at 2.4 g/t from 110 metres, including 1 metre at 7.6 g/t from 118 metres.

These results are from the same area of Skyhawk that returned a result of 16 metres at 4.4 g/t gold, from 54 metres, which included a section of 6 metres at 8.2 g/t.

Skyhawk’s open-pit potential

These new broad gold intersections add to a growing body of high-grade gold returns from Skyhawk, with historical results including:

➢ 18 metres at 2.0 g/t gold, from 76 metres, including 1 metre at 8.5 g/t;

➢ 16 metres at 3.5 g/t from 132 metres;

➢ 12 metres at 2.5 g/t from 65 metres;

➢ 18 metres at 2.0 g/t from 76 metres;

➢ 7 metres at 4.6 g/t from 67 metres; and,

➢ 5 metres at 6.4 g/t from 84 metres.

Collectively Vango believes these results confirm the potential for an open-pit resource at Skyhawk to add materially to the existing 1-million-ounce resource already held at the Marymia project.

In light of this, the company has commissioned Dr Spero Carras to compile a resource upgrade, expected at the end of the second quarter this year.

About Vango Mining

Vango Mining is an exploration company with the aim of becoming a high-grade gold miner through developing the 100%-owned Marymia Gold Project in WA's Mid-West.

The Marymia Project comprises 45 granted mining leases spread over a 300 square kilometres area and has an established high-grade resource of 1 million ounces at 3 g/t gold, underpinned by Trident with 410,000 ounces at 8 g/t.

Besides Marymia, Vango is also testing several much larger-scale targets, looking for repeats of Plutonic-style mineralisation.
